In the charming village of Lucignano d'Asso, Tuscany this 1943 threshing machine was being illuminated by the most wonderful reflected and diffuse light making it appear to glow.

It was hard to establish composition and camera viewpoint to try to give a geometric feel with the circles, horizontal, diagonal and vertical lines. What to include or omit?

The white splashes are swallow/swift excrement. They were whizzing in and out whilst feeding their young. They didn't bestow any 'medals' on me, whilst making the image!

Front rise and rear shift only.
